Latent hostility

Latent hostility Meaning & Definition
Latent hostility Definition And Meaning

What's The Definition Of Latent hostility?

[n] feelings of hostility that are not manifest; "he could sense her latent hostility to him"; "the diplomats' first concern was to reduce international tensions"

Synonyms | Synonyms for Latent hostility: tension
